靶场云环境搭建荐

# 靶场环境搭建
看了下自己以前写的靶场搭建的文章感觉跟shi一样
现在重新写下,直接把靶场上服务器当网站用了
使用的重装后的云服务器,环境比较干净
centos+docker 感觉很方便
1. docker
2. sqli-labs
3. dvwa
4. vulhub
## 安装docker
curl -fsSL https://get.docker.com | bash -s docker --mirror aliyun
![](https://s4.51cto.co推送微信名片怎么弄m/images/bvial环境保护og/202105/27/e3d5af6be1fff37ecc570cc60119ea30.png?x-oss-profilecoin价格今日行情cess=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_F47虎虎的新域名FFFFF,t_100,g_se,x_10,y_10,s如果是理想中的女儿就算是世界最hadow_20,type_ZmFuZ3poZW5naGVpdGk=42度汾酒20年)
设置阿里云docker仓库
yum-config-manager --add-repo https ://mirrors.aliywebtoonun.com/docker-ce/linux/centos/docker-ce.rep推送消息o
![](https://s4.51cto.com/images/blograced/202105/27/74c7ac4e7a875ac455b646caf253cad1.png?x-oss-process=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)
启动d52ocker,查看docker状态,设置开机自启
systemctl start/status/enable docker
![](https://s4.51cto.com/images/b环境污染log/202105/27/93d7374df783822719cd7f228644427c.png?x-oss-pro626课堂禁毒登录入口cess=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_搭建100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)
检查是否安装成功,看下docker版如果是一城山水一场空是什么歌
docker version
![](https://s4.51cto.com/images/blog/202105/27/160cbe1366c26f28a3333a服务器bdae19f438.png?x-ossraced-process=image/watermark,size_14,text_QDUxQ1RP5Y环境英语2a5a6i,color_FFFFFF,t_100,g_se62度白酒有哪些,x_10,y_10,s如果是这样像梦一场是什么歌hadow_20,type_ZmrachelFuZ3对称图形poZW5naGVpdGk=)
再跑racket下helloworld
docker run hello-world
没有的话敲一个 docker pull hello-world
![](https://s4.51cto.com/images/blog/202105/27/e9a06775a5ce1dacd31dcec24ba6推送消息怎么关闭55d1.png?x-oss-process=image/waterm52岁属什么生肖ark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FF如果是这样你不要悲哀是什么歌F云环境是什么FF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3po云倾北冥夜煊免费阅读ZW5naGVpdGk=)
## 安装sqli-labs
查找sqli-labs镜像
docker search sqli-labs
![](https://s4.51cto.co推送是什么意思m/images/blog/202105/27/3033d179f0f5369f38a19a70da6eb75b.png?x-oss-process=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k42923=)
这里我安装的是第服务行业的服务理念一个
docker pull acgpiano/sqli-labs
![](https://s4.51cto.com/images/blog/202105/27/1df1a4dab26d4e307822871e6bd50801.png?x-oss-process=image/watermark,size_web浏览器14,text_QDUxQ1RP对称加密技术5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y云绾宁墨晔_10,shadow_20,tyracepe_ZmFuZ3poZW5naGVpdGk=)
查看安装的镜像
docker images
![](https://s4.51cto.com/images/blog/202105/27/b4fabe7a1a96654dbb2677cbbf5d848a.png?x-oss-process=image/w表盘自定义工具atermark,size_14,text_QDUxQ1RP5Y2a5a非对称加密名词解释6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)
运行镜像
docker run -dt --name sqli -p 80:80 --rm acgpia120平米花6万装修效果no/sqli-lab42码的鞋子是多少厘米s
dt:后台运行
--name:设置别名
-p 设置端口映射 本地端口:容器端口
--rm 选择运行的镜像
![](https://s4.51cto.com/images推送服务是什么意思/blo42923金牛版g/202105/27/0ae2ef165aa7bda400eb14b0ba98a6cb.png?x-oss-pr626ocess=image/watermark,size_14,te如果是一城山水一场空是什么歌xt_QDUxQ1RP5Y2a5a6i,co服务员英文lor_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5nwebstormaGVpdGk=)
然后直接访问即可
![](https://s4.51cto.com/images/blog/202105/27/58981bb6c84f66b服务的拼音85e8248f8223d017b.png?x-os62年出生今年多大s-process=image/watermark,size_1racist4,text_QD42UxQ1RP5Y2a5a6i,color_FFFFFF,奔跑吧兄弟第九季免费观看t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)
网上很多文章都少了一步,521数字代表什么意思现在这样用是用不了的
![](https://s4.51vivo游戏中心cto.com/如果是一城山水一场空是什么歌images/blog/202105/27/9861834412da700140e79eaca93a5c8a.png?x-oss-process=image/watermark推送是什么意思,size_14,text_QDUxQ1RP5Y2a5a6i,co120平米装修全包lor_FFFFFF,t_100,g_se,x_10,y_10,s云环境下的数据安全策略是什么hadow_5220,type_ZmFuZ3poZW5naGVpdGk=)
需要重置下数据库,就好了
![](https://s4.51cto.com/images/blog/202105/27/1cb8e78030195537cbe97运行窗口怎么打开40a86044704.pn服务员英文g?x-oss-process=image/watermark,sizviewe_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Vp525心理网dGk=)
![](https://s4.51cto.com/images/bl62年出生今年多大og/202105/27/7dfb88d0c208b76947df7fba57246121.png?x-oss-520和521的区别是什么process=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,服务密码忘了怎么查询x_10,y_10,shadow_20,type_ZmFuZ5253poZW5naGVpdGk=)
![](https://s4.51cto.com/images/blog/202105/27/2b9ae2946b93BP482721e0ec937a6da42923637.png?x-oss-process=image/watermark,size_14,text_QDUxQ1RP5Y2araced5a6i,color_FFFFFFweb是什么意思,t_100,g_se,x_1环境保护0,y_10,shadow_20,type_ZmFuZ3racingpoZW5naGVpdGk=)
## dvwa
操作跟上面类似,不细写了
这里用的都是一个ip,sqli用的80端口,这个就设置81端口,避云环境搭建免冲突
默认登录账号/密码:云闪付admin/password
docker search dvwa
docker pull citizenstig/dvwa
docker run -dt --name dvwa -p 81:80 --rm citizensti47码男鞋g/dvwa
![](https:/vivo云服务登录/s4.51cto.com/images/blog/202105/27/c4c1438fdcffb5d7扁平足817b41180f3f648d.pn非对称加密的优缺点g?x626-oss-process=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_2linux命令0,type_ZmFuZ3poZW5naGVpdGk=)
访问81端口即可
![](https://s4推送服务可以卸载吗.51cto.com/images/blog/202105/27/e搭建服务器80e如果是这样你不要悲哀是什么歌baeba366875df20036962620dccb.png?x-oss-process=image/watermark,size_14,text_QDUx47公斤是多少斤Q1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)
## vulhub
先安装docker-compose
52书库作者分类网的链接有点问题,又找了一个
curl -L http运行快捷键ctrl加什么s:// github.com/docker/compose/releases/download/1.22.0/docker-compose-`uname -s`-`uname -m` -o /usr/local/bin/docker-compose //以图片命令为准,符号冲突了
chmod对称矩阵 +x /usr/local/bin/docweb浏览器ker-compose
![](https:webstorm//s4.51cto.com/images/blog/202105/27/9b447fdeb36360f3da349如果是什么意思3a5c5c15a75.png?x-oss-process=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_1环境工程0,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)
安装git指令
yum -ywebview install git
git version
![](https://s4.51cto.com/images/blog/202对称轴105/27/e6719云南大学0626c4c28fcd8b266679579b358.png?x-oss-process=image/water环境污染mark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FF如果是什么意思FF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5环境设计naGVpdGk=)
下载vulhub
git clone https:// github.com/vulhub/vulhub.git
下载后访问vulhub目录,可以看到漏洞非对称加密的优缺点环境
![](https://s4.51cto.com/images/blog/202105/27/427233bfile的意思a0f6craced3d42f504f2e17f69f807.png?x-oss-process=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_42se,x_1推送0,y_10,shadow47码男鞋_20,t运行内存如何清理ype_ZmFuZ3poZW5naGVpdGk=)
例如安装wordpr对称图形图片大全ess漏洞环境
进入漏洞目录下
cd wordpress/pwnscriptum/
安装环境
docker-compose up -d
查看端口信息
docker ps
![](https://s4.51cto.com/images/blog/202105/27/163b893600fd5871dcde220c1186d149.png?x-oss-process=image/watermark,size_14搭建帐篷的英文,text_QDUxQ1RP5Y2a5a6i,colorweb_FFFFFF,t_100,g_se,x_10,linux是什么操作系统y_10,shadow_20,typ运行内存e_ZmFuZ3poZW5naGVpdGk=)
看到开的是8080端口,访问8080端口即可,后linux操作系统基础知识续自己安装就好了
![](https://s4.51cto.com/images/blog/202105/27/566c88dcb1322f75ca17bdf498ddd2e8.png?x-oss-process=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)
关闭环境,先切换到漏洞目录下,再执行停止62命令
docker-120hz刷新率compose down
![](https://s4.51cto.com/images/blog/202105/27/e3f6a403658dea2bed83332e419c62f8.png?x-oss-process=fileassistor是什么软件image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)